Government GLDM Degree College releases news letter
7/29/2022 11:20:08 PM
Early Times Report
JAMMU, July 29: Govt. GLDM Degree College Hiranagar released "Quality Reporter" a newsletter to showcase the different initiatives and undertakings of the college. The newsletter was released in a short event presided over by the Principal of College; Dr. Pragya Khanna in the presence of other staff members.
The college through this newsletter envisages strategic planning in the context of finances, budgeting, staffing and academic programming as fundamental to the development and progress of the institution. Further the mission of the college is exhibited as the promotion of quality education, empowerment of women, introduction of innovative courses, to develop all round personality of students and to offer a wide choice of courses in various disciplines at UG level. In terms of institutional core values the college endeavours to take much efforts and interest to empower education on moral and ethical grounds. The issues related to gender sensitization and an eco-friendly environment have also been given due importance. In brief college focuses on the question of cultural and social development, welfare measures for the conducive environment, and opportunities for all according to their ability.
The Principal of the College in her message described that Internal Quality Assurance Cell (IQAC) of Govt. GLDM Degree College Hiranagar was formed with the vision to work for the excellence in academics as well as to synergize all the constituent units including the stakeholders of the College. As a part of its developing and all-encompassing quality IQAC plays a greater role in congregating the institutional effort for quality assurance of the college. She also described how IQAC periodically reviews the college on quality parameters and improve its quality and efficiency.
